服务器 虚拟主机的区别,服务器和虚拟主机哪个稳定
- 综合资讯
- 2024-10-02 04:00:44
- 2

***:服务器是独立的物理设备,可根据需求自由配置资源,有完全的控制权。虚拟主机是在服务器上划分出的多个空间,多个用户共用服务器资源。在稳定性方面,服务器硬件资源独享,...
***:服务器是独立的物理设备,具有完整的硬件资源,可自行配置各种环境。虚拟主机是在服务器上通过虚拟化技术划分出的一定资源空间。在稳定性方面,服务器通常更稳定,因为资源独享且可定制化程度高,能根据需求灵活配置安全防护等措施。而虚拟主机资源共享,可能受其他用户影响,不过正规的、有良好资源管理的虚拟主机也能提供相对稳定的服务,具体选择取决于用户的需求和预算等因素。
《服务器与虚拟主机稳定性对比:深度剖析两者的差异与影响稳定性的因素》
一、引言
在当今的网络环境中,无论是企业构建网站还是开发者部署应用,都需要在服务器和虚拟主机之间做出选择,稳定性是衡量它们性能的一个关键指标,直接关系到网站或应用能否持续、可靠地运行,了解服务器和虚拟主机的区别以及它们各自稳定性的特点,对于做出正确的决策至关重要。
二、服务器与虚拟主机的区别
1、概念定义
服务器
- 服务器是一台物理计算机设备,它具有强大的计算能力、存储能力和网络连接能力,服务器通常配备高性能的处理器、大容量的内存和硬盘,能够运行各种操作系统,如Linux、Windows Server等,它可以独立运行多个服务,如Web服务、邮件服务、数据库服务等,一个企业可以购买一台服务器,在上面安装Web服务器软件(如Apache或Nginx)来托管公司的官方网站,同时还可以安装数据库管理系统(如MySQL或Oracle)来存储网站的数据。
虚拟主机
- 虚拟主机是在一台物理服务器上通过虚拟化技术划分出来的多个独立的小服务器空间,每个虚拟主机都有自己的域名、独立的网站目录,可以被视为一个独立的网站托管环境,多个用户可以共享一台物理服务器的资源,虚拟主机提供商通过技术手段将服务器的资源(如CPU、内存、硬盘空间、带宽等)分配给不同的用户,一个小型企业或个人博客主可以租用虚拟主机来托管自己的网站,他们不需要购买和维护自己的物理服务器。
2、资源分配
服务器
- 对于服务器而言,用户拥有整台服务器的资源控制权,可以根据自己的需求自由分配CPU、内存、硬盘等资源,如果运行一个大型电子商务网站,需要大量的内存来处理并发用户的请求和存储海量的商品信息,可以将服务器的大部分内存分配给Web服务器和数据库服务器进程,如果需要扩展存储容量,可以直接添加硬盘或者使用网络存储设备,在资源分配上具有很高的灵活性。
虚拟主机
- 在虚拟主机环境下,资源分配是由虚拟主机提供商预先设定的,通常会根据用户购买的虚拟主机套餐来分配一定量的CPU使用率、内存大小、硬盘空间和每月的带宽流量,一个基本的虚拟主机套餐可能提供1GB的内存、5GB的硬盘空间和100GB/月的带宽流量,如果网站的流量突然增大,超过了所分配的带宽,可能会导致网站速度变慢甚至暂时无法访问,因为虚拟主机用户无法像服务器用户那样自由地增加资源。
3、性能隔离
服务器
- 由于服务器是独立运行的,不同的服务之间可以根据需要进行性能隔离,可以将Web服务器和数据库服务器部署在同一台服务器上,通过配置防火墙规则和资源分配策略,确保Web服务器的高流量访问不会过度影响数据库服务器的性能,如果需要进一步隔离性能,可以使用容器化技术(如Docker)或者虚拟机技术(如VMware)在服务器内部创建独立的运行环境。
虚拟主机
- 虚拟主机虽然在技术上是独立的小服务器空间,但由于多个虚拟主机共享一台物理服务器的资源,在性能隔离方面存在一定的局限性,如果同一台物理服务器上的某个虚拟主机遭受了大量的流量攻击或者资源占用(如某个用户的脚本出现无限循环占用大量CPU资源),可能会影响到其他虚拟主机的性能,尽管虚拟主机提供商通常会采取一些措施来防止这种情况的发生,如资源限制和监控,但这种共享资源的模式在一定程度上仍然存在性能相互影响的风险。
4、成本
服务器
- 购买服务器需要一次性投入较高的成本,包括服务器硬件设备本身的价格、操作系统的许可证费用(如果使用商业操作系统)、网络设备(如交换机、路由器等)以及机房托管费用(如果不选择在自己的办公场所放置服务器),还需要考虑服务器的维护成本,如硬件维修、软件更新、电力消耗等,不过,对于大型企业或者对资源有特殊需求的用户来说,拥有自己的服务器可以提供更高的定制性和安全性。
虚拟主机
- 虚拟主机的成本相对较低,适合中小企业和个人用户,用户只需根据自己的需求选择不同的虚拟主机套餐,按照月或年支付一定的租用费用,虚拟主机提供商负责服务器的硬件维护、网络连接、电力供应等,用户只需要管理自己的网站内容,一个基本的虚拟主机套餐可能每月只需要几美元到几十美元不等,大大降低了网站托管的成本。
5、管理维护
服务器
- 服务器的管理维护需要较高的技术水平和专业知识,用户需要负责服务器的操作系统安装、配置、安全防护、软件更新等一系列工作,要确保服务器的操作系统及时打上安全补丁,防止黑客攻击;需要配置防火墙规则来限制网络访问;还需要对服务器上运行的服务(如Web服务、数据库服务等)进行优化和故障排除,如果服务器出现硬件故障,还需要有相应的技术人员进行维修或者更换硬件设备。
虚拟主机
- 虚拟主机的管理相对简单,用户主要关注自己的网站内容管理,虚拟主机提供商负责服务器的大部分管理维护工作,包括服务器的硬件维护、网络配置、安全防护等,用户只需要使用FTP等工具上传自己的网站文件,通过控制面板(如cPanel)来管理自己的网站域名、电子邮箱等设置,对于技术能力有限的中小企业和个人用户来说,虚拟主机的管理维护方式更加便捷。
三、影响服务器和虚拟主机稳定性的因素
1、硬件方面
服务器
硬件质量:服务器的硬件质量直接影响其稳定性,高质量的服务器硬件,如品牌服务器(如戴尔、惠普等),通常采用优质的组件,包括高性能的处理器、可靠的内存模块和硬盘,企业级的服务器硬盘具有更高的转速(如15000转/分钟)和更好的容错能力(如RAID技术),能够在高负载下稳定运行并且减少数据丢失的风险,如果服务器的硬件组件出现故障,可能会导致整个服务器停机,影响网站或应用的正常运行。
硬件冗余:服务器可以通过配置硬件冗余来提高稳定性,采用冗余电源模块,当一个电源出现故障时,另一个电源可以继续为服务器供电,确保服务器不会因为电源问题而突然关机,同样,冗余的网络接口卡(NIC)可以在一个网卡出现故障时,自动切换到另一个网卡,保证网络连接的稳定性,磁盘阵列(RAID)技术可以通过数据冗余来防止硬盘故障导致的数据丢失,提高存储系统的稳定性。
虚拟主机
物理服务器硬件:虚拟主机的稳定性在一定程度上依赖于其所共享的物理服务器硬件,如果物理服务器的硬件出现故障,如硬盘损坏或者内存模块故障,可能会影响到所有共享该服务器的虚拟主机,不过,正规的虚拟主机提供商通常会采用高质量的服务器硬件,并采取一定的冗余措施来降低这种风险,他们可能会使用企业级的服务器,并配置RAID阵列来保护数据,使用冗余电源来确保电力供应的稳定性。
资源分配硬件限制:虚拟主机的资源分配是基于物理服务器硬件的,如果物理服务器的硬件资源有限,可能会影响虚拟主机的稳定性,如果物理服务器的CPU性能不足,当多个虚拟主机同时面临高负载时,可能会导致各个虚拟主机的响应速度变慢,甚至出现网站无法访问的情况,同样,如果物理服务器的内存容量不够,可能会导致虚拟主机之间的资源竞争加剧,影响稳定性。
2、软件方面
服务器
操作系统稳定性:服务器所运行的操作系统对稳定性有着至关重要的影响,不同的操作系统有不同的特点,Linux操作系统以其稳定性和安全性而闻名,被广泛应用于服务器领域,即使是Linux系统,如果没有正确配置和及时更新,也可能会出现稳定性问题,内核版本过旧可能存在安全漏洞,容易被黑客攻击,从而影响服务器的稳定运行,对于Windows Server系统,也需要进行定期的更新和安全配置,以确保其稳定性。
应用程序兼容性:服务器上运行的各种应用程序(如Web服务器软件、数据库管理系统等)之间的兼容性也会影响稳定性,如果应用程序之间存在版本不兼容或者配置冲突,可能会导致服务器出现故障,某些版本的PHP脚本语言与MySQL数据库可能存在兼容性问题,如果在服务器上同时使用这两个软件,可能会导致网站的某些功能无法正常运行或者出现错误。
虚拟主机
虚拟主机管理软件:虚拟主机提供商通常使用特定的虚拟主机管理软件(如cPanel、Plesk等)来管理虚拟主机,这些软件的稳定性直接影响到虚拟主机的正常运行,如果管理软件出现故障,可能会导致用户无法正常管理自己的虚拟主机,如无法上传文件、无法创建数据库等,管理软件的安全性也很重要,如果存在安全漏洞,可能会被黑客利用,危及虚拟主机的安全和稳定。
共享软件环境影响:由于虚拟主机是共享的软件环境,不同用户的网站可能使用不同的脚本语言、数据库系统等,如果某个用户的网站脚本存在漏洞或者恶意代码,可能会影响到整个服务器上其他虚拟主机的稳定性,一个被黑客攻击的虚拟主机上的恶意脚本可能会消耗大量的服务器资源,导致其他虚拟主机的性能下降甚至无法正常访问。
3、网络方面
服务器
网络带宽:服务器的网络带宽是影响其稳定性的重要因素,如果服务器的网络带宽不足,当面临高流量访问时,可能会导致网站或应用的响应速度变慢甚至无法访问,一个热门的电子商务网站在促销活动期间,如果服务器的网络带宽无法满足大量用户同时访问的需求,用户可能会遇到页面加载缓慢、无法下单等问题,网络带宽的稳定性也很重要,如果网络连接经常出现波动或者中断,会严重影响服务器的稳定性。
网络安全防护:服务器需要具备强大的网络安全防护能力来抵御网络攻击,常见的网络攻击如DDoS攻击(分布式拒绝服务攻击)可以通过发送大量的请求来淹没服务器,使其无法正常响应合法用户的请求,如果服务器没有有效的DDoS防护措施,如防火墙、入侵检测系统等,很容易在遭受攻击时出现不稳定甚至瘫痪的情况。
虚拟主机
共享网络资源:虚拟主机共享物理服务器的网络资源,这意味着如果同一台物理服务器上的某个虚拟主机占用了过多的网络资源(如带宽),可能会影响到其他虚拟主机的网络稳定性,一个虚拟主机用户在进行大文件下载或者视频流传输时,如果没有流量限制,可能会耗尽服务器的网络带宽,导致其他虚拟主机的网站访问速度变慢。
网络安全隔离:虽然虚拟主机提供商通常会采取一些网络安全隔离措施,但在共享网络环境下,仍然存在一定的安全风险,如果一个虚拟主机被黑客攻击并被用作攻击其他网站的跳板,可能会影响到其他虚拟主机的网络稳定性和安全性,黑客可能会利用被攻击的虚拟主机发送大量的垃圾邮件或者进行网络扫描,从而引起网络服务提供商的注意,可能会对整个物理服务器的网络连接进行限制,影响所有虚拟主机的正常使用。
4、维护管理方面
服务器
专业维护团队:服务器的维护需要专业的技术团队,如果没有足够的技术人员进行服务器的日常维护,如系统监控、故障排除等,可能会导致服务器出现稳定性问题,没有及时发现服务器的硬件故障预警信号,可能会使小故障演变成大问题,最终导致服务器停机,专业的维护团队还可以对服务器进行性能优化,确保服务器在高负载下也能稳定运行。
备份与恢复策略:服务器需要有完善的备份与恢复策略,如果没有定期进行数据备份,一旦服务器出现故障(如硬盘损坏、数据被误删除等),可能会导致数据丢失,影响网站或应用的正常运行,备份数据的恢复过程也需要进行测试,以确保在紧急情况下能够快速、准确地恢复数据。
虚拟主机
提供商的管理水平:虚拟主机的稳定性很大程度上取决于虚拟主机提供商的管理水平,一个好的虚拟主机提供商应该有专业的技术团队来维护服务器,包括硬件维护、软件更新、安全防护等,如果提供商的管理不善,如没有及时更新服务器的安全补丁,可能会导致虚拟主机面临安全风险,从而影响其稳定性。
用户自身管理:虽然虚拟主机提供商负责大部分的管理工作,但用户自身的管理也会影响虚拟主机的稳定性,用户如果上传了恶意代码或者配置错误的脚本到虚拟主机,可能会导致网站出现故障或者被黑客攻击,用户需要遵循虚拟主机提供商的使用规则,正确管理自己的网站内容。
四、服务器和虚拟主机稳定性对比结论
1、总体稳定性评估
服务器
- 服务器在硬件资源、性能隔离和定制性方面具有优势,这使得它在稳定性方面有较好的表现,如果企业或用户有足够的技术能力和资金来构建和维护自己的服务器,并且对稳定性有较高的要求,服务器是一个较好的选择,大型金融机构、电商巨头等通常会选择自己构建和管理服务器,以确保其核心业务系统的高度稳定运行,通过采用高质量的硬件、冗余配置、专业的维护团队和完善的安全防护措施,可以将服务器的稳定性提升到很高的水平。
虚拟主机
- 虚拟主机对于中小企业和个人用户来说是一种性价比很高的选择,虽然在稳定性方面可能会受到共享资源和管理限制等因素的影响,但正规的虚拟主机提供商通过采用高质量的物理服务器、合理的资源分配、有效的安全防护和管理软件,可以提供相对稳定的服务,对于流量较小、对成本比较敏感的网站来说,虚拟主机的稳定性通常可以满足需求,一个小型的企业宣传网站或者个人博客,使用虚拟主机可以在较低的成本下实现稳定的运行。
2、适用场景推荐
服务器
- 适合大型企业、对安全性和定制性要求极高的组织、有大量并发用户需求的应用(如大型在线游戏、视频流媒体平台等),这些场景下,服务器能够提供足够的资源、高度的性能隔离和定制化的安全防护措施,以确保业务的稳定运行,在线游戏公司需要服务器来处理大量玩家的实时交互请求,并且要保护用户数据的安全,服务器的独立运行模式可以满足这些需求。
虚拟主机
- 适合中小企业、创业公司、个人开发者和个人网站所有者,这些用户通常预算有限,对技术维护的要求不高,并且网站流量相对较小,虚拟主机的低成本和简单管理模式可以让他们轻松地将网站上线并保持相对稳定的运行,一个小型的本地服务型企业只需要一个简单的网站来展示公司信息和服务内容,虚拟主机就可以满足其需求。
服务器和虚拟主机在稳定性方面各有优劣,用户需要根据自己的具体需求、预算和技术能力来选择适合自己的网站或应用托管方案。
本文链接:https://www.zhitaoyun.cn/120043.html
发表评论